Abstract
The utility model relates to a kind of range hoods with deflector.Solving existing range hood internal cavity is cavity, and vortex is easy to produce in fume-exhausting, low oil smoke separating degree, draught fan impeller and spiral case greasy dirt is caused to adhere to serious problem.Kitchen ventilator includes shell, there is the panel of air inlet in housing forward end setting, spiral case is installed in shell, volute air-inlet mouth is equipped on spiral case, blower is installed in spiral case, the deflector for being connected to volute air-inlet mouth periphery is installed, deflector is located at the rear end of the air inlet, and the air-flow of air inlet is drained to volute air-inlet mouth by the deflector in shell.Increase deflector on kitchen ventilator inner spiral casing air inlet, the air-flow entered from air inlet is drained to volute air-inlet mouth along deflector and is directly sucked in, the condensation of oil smoke is accelerated, increases grease separating degree, reduces the attachment of draught fan impeller and spiral case to greasy dirt.
